use bevy::prelude::*;
use bevy_archie::prelude::*;
use std::fmt::Write;
fn main() {
App::new()
.add_plugins(DefaultPlugins)
.add_plugins(ControllerPlugin::default())
.add_systems(Startup, setup)
.add_systems(Update, (display_controller_info, demonstrate_database))
.run();
}
fn setup(mut commands: Commands) {
commands.spawn(Camera2d);
commands.spawn((
Text::new(
"Controller Detection Database Example\n\nConnect a controller to see its details...",
),
TextFont {
font_size: 24.0,
..default()
},
TextColor(Color::WHITE),
Node {
position_type: PositionType::Absolute,
left: Val::Px(10.0),
top: Val::Px(10.0),
..default()
},
));
}
fn display_controller_info(
detected_query: Query<(&DetectedController, &Gamepad), Added<DetectedController>>,
mut text_query: Query<&mut Text>,
) {
for (detected, _gamepad) in &detected_query {
let mut info = format!(
"Controller Detected!\n\n\
Model: {:?}\n\
VID: 0x{:04X}\n\
PID: 0x{:04X}\n\n",
detected.model, detected.vendor_id, detected.product_id
);
info.push_str("Capabilities:\n");
if detected.model.supports_gyro() {
info.push_str(" ✓ Gyroscope/Motion Control\n");
}
if detected.model.supports_touchpad() {
info.push_str(" ✓ Touchpad\n");
}
if detected.model.supports_adaptive_triggers() {
info.push_str(" ✓ Adaptive Triggers (DualSense)\n");
}
if detected.model.supports_pressure_buttons() {
info.push_str(" ✓ Pressure-Sensitive Buttons (DualShock 3)\n");
}
let _ = write!(
info,
"\nButton Layout: {:?}\n",
detected.model.default_layout()
);
let _ = writeln!(info, "Connection: {:?}", detected.connection_type_hint());
let quirks = detected.quirks();
if !quirks.is_empty() {
info.push_str("\nSpecial Handling Required:\n");
for quirk in quirks {
let _ = writeln!(info, " • {quirk:?}");
}
}
for mut text in &mut text_query {
text.0.clone_from(&info);
}
println!("{info}");
}
}

#[allow(dead_code)]
fn print_supported_controllers() {
use bevy_archie::profiles::DetectedController;
println!("Supported Controllers:\n");
let ps3 = DetectedController::new(0x054c, 0x0268);
println!("✓ PlayStation 3 DualShock 3 - {:?}", ps3.model);
let ps4_usb = DetectedController::new(0x054c, 0x05c4);
println!("✓ PlayStation 4 DualShock 4 (USB) - {:?}", ps4_usb.model);
let ps4_bt = DetectedController::new(0x054c, 0x09cc);
println!("✓ PlayStation 4 DualShock 4 (BT) - {:?}", ps4_bt.model);
let ps5 = DetectedController::new(0x054c, 0x0ce6);
println!("✓ PlayStation 5 DualSense - {:?}", ps5.model);
let xbox360 = DetectedController::new(0x045e, 0x028e);
println!("✓ Xbox 360 - {:?}", xbox360.model);
let xboxone = DetectedController::new(0x045e, 0x02d1);
println!("✓ Xbox One - {:?}", xboxone.model);
let xboxseries = DetectedController::new(0x045e, 0x0b13);
println!("✓ Xbox Series X|S - {:?}", xboxseries.model);
let switch_pro = DetectedController::new(0x057e, 0x2009);
println!("✓ Switch Pro Controller - {:?}", switch_pro.model);
let joycon_l = DetectedController::new(0x057e, 0x2006);
println!("✓ Switch Joy-Con Left - {:?}", joycon_l.model);
let ns2_pro = DetectedController::new(0x057e, 0x2072);
println!("✓ Switch 2 Pro Controller - {:?}", ns2_pro.model);
let steam = DetectedController::new(0x28de, 0x1142);
println!("✓ Steam Controller - {:?}", steam.model);
let stadia = DetectedController::new(0x18d1, 0x9400);
println!("✓ Google Stadia (Bluetooth) - {:?}", stadia.model);
let eightbitdo_m30 = DetectedController::new(0x2dc8, 0x5006);
println!("✓ 8BitDo M30 - {:?}", eightbitdo_m30.model);
let eightbitdo_sn30 = DetectedController::new(0x2dc8, 0x6001);
println!("✓ 8BitDo SN30 Pro - {:?}", eightbitdo_sn30.model);
println!("\nTotal: 15+ controllers with hardware-specific support");
}
